Установка локального сервера (Денвер)
При разработке любого сайта рекомендуется использовать локальный сервер. В этом случае нам нет нужны постоянно обновлять файлы на хостинге, мы будем править код на своем рабочем компьютере и сразу видеть изменения. Мы даже сможем работать без интернета.
В нашем примере мы будем использовать локальный сервер от Denwer.
Denwer (Денвер) — это набор дистрибутивов и программная оболочка, которые используются при создании и отладке сайтов или веб-приложений на локальном компьютере. Название происходит от аббревиатуры «Д.н.w.р» — джентльменский набор Web-разработчика.
Итак, приступим!
Для начала нам нужна последняя версия Denwer. Скачать ее можно бесплатно на сайте http://www.denwer.ru
Установка Денвер`а
Запустите скачанный инсталлятор Денвера. Вы увидите перед собой нечто вроде следующего:
Вас спросят о том, в какой каталог вы хотели бы установить комплекс (по умолчанию используется C:\WebServers
, вам нужно лишь нажать Enter
, чтобы согласиться с этим выбором). В указанном каталоге будут расположены абсолютно все компоненты системы, и вне его никакие файлы в дальнейшем не создаются (исключая ярлыки на Рабочем столе).
Настоятельно рекомендуется устанавливать комплекс в каталог первого уровня — то есть, C:\WebServers
, а не, например, C:\MyWeb\WebServers
.
Далее вводим имя виртуального диска (можно любое, но уже не занятое системой), например, как по умолчанию (Z:
).
После этого начнется копирование файлов дистрибутива, а под конец вам будет задан вопрос, как именно вы собираетесь запускать и останавливать комплекс. У вас есть две альтернативы:
- Создавать виртуальный диск при загрузке машины.
- Создавать виртуальный диск только по явной команде старта.
Кому как удобно, я же использую второй, диск создается при щелчке по ярлыку запуска на Рабочем столе, и отключается, соответственно, при остановке серверов (ярлык остановки).
Первый запуск Денвера
Сразу же щелкайте по созданному инсталлятором ярлыку Start Denwer на Рабочем столе, а затем, дождавшись, когда все консольные окна исчезнут, открывайте браузер и набирайте в нем адрес: http://localhost
.
И вот, нас радует поздравительное окно!
Опробовать работу набора можно добавив новый виртуальный хост (сайт).
Добавить новый виртуальный хост в Денвере чрезвычайно просто. Пусть это будет test1.com. Вам нужно проделать следующее:
- Создать в папке
/home
(путьc:/WebServers/home/
) директорию с именем, совпадающим с именем виртуального хоста (в нашем случаеtest1.com
). А в этой папке, папку с названиемwww
(получилосьc:/WebServers/home/test1.com/www
). Здесь мы будем хранить все страницы и скрипты сайта. - Перезапустить сервер, воспользовавшись, ярлыком Restart Denwer на Рабочем столе (эта процедура обновит список хостов в файле
c:/Windows/System32/drivers/etc/hosts
и добавит наш новыйtest1.com
)
Теперь, когда мы введем в браузере test1.com
, то нам откроется сайт с таким именем (при условии, что в выше указанной папке все файлы сайта мы разместили).
Собственно, вот и вся установка локального сервера.
И в дополнение к посту посмотрите видео-урок:
можно почитать еще: Как установить локальный сервер XAMPP
Последние посты
Томас Эдисон
Наша самая большая слабость заключается в том, что мы быстро сдаемся. Самый верный способ добиться… Читать далее
Самые красивые и впечатляющие мосты со всего мира (ТОП-10)
Мост — это нечто большее, чем просто сооружение, соединяющее два берега. Для того, чтобы появился… Читать далее
Соломон
Жизнь нас учит, что свою пару мы познаем, когда разводимся, своих братьев мы познаем, когда… Читать далее
Чак Паланик
Кто может — тот делает. Кто не может — тот критикует Чак Паланик Читать далее
Ричард Бах
Ни одно желание не дается тебе отдельно от силы, позволяющей его осуществить. Хотя, возможно, для… Читать далее
Стивен Кинг
Жизнь – это непрерывный опыт, и даже самые плохие моменты занимают свое место в пазле… Читать далее